Understanding Goalie Heads

Lacrosse goalie heads are crucial in determining a goalie's effectiveness in the game. They are designed to be wider than offensive and defensive heads to make it easier to block shots. The design, weight, durability, and flexibility of the goalie head can significantly impact performance.

Key Factors to Consider

1. Design and Shape

The shape of the goalie head can influence how well you can stop shots. Goalie heads typically have a wider face to provide a larger area for blocking. Some heads are designed with a more pronounced flare at the top to help catch high shots, while others may have a more gradual flare, offering a balanced approach for different types of saves.

2. Weight

The weight of the goalie head is important for quick reactions and ease of handling. Heavier heads may offer more durability and sturdiness, which can be beneficial for withstanding powerful shots. However, lighter heads can improve reaction time and reduce fatigue over extended periods of play.

3. Durability

Goalie heads must be able to withstand repeated impacts from the ball. High-quality materials such as advanced plastics or composite materials can enhance durability. It’s important to choose a head that maintains its shape and strength throughout the season.

4. Flexibility

The flexibility of a goalie head affects how it responds to shots. Some goalies prefer stiffer heads for their ability to provide a more consistent blocking surface and better control when clearing the ball. Others might opt for more flexible heads that can absorb the impact of shots, making it easier to catch and control the ball.

5. Pocket Customization

The ability to customize the pocket of the goalie head is crucial. A deeper pocket can help with ball control and catching, while a shallower pocket can allow for quicker ball release. Look for heads that offer multiple stringing holes to enable various stringing patterns and pocket depths.
